The landrace: a single place, a single lineage

Durban Poison's genetic distinctiveness comes from its origin. Most modern strains are layered hybrids — Gelato is Sunset Sherbet × Thin Mint GSC; Sunset Sherbet is GSC × Pink Panties; each of those is itself a cross. Durban Poison is the opposite: a pure sativa that developed in one geographic region, shaped by the subtropical coastal climate of Durban and KwaZulu-Natal without deliberate hybridization. When the Cookie Fam breeder Jigga crossed it with OG Kush, he wasn't combining two hybrids. He was combining one of the world's most complex, resin-dense indica hybrids with one of the world's purest sativa lines — and the combination produced GSC's characteristic two-phase effect arc.

The strain reached the West through Ed Rosenthal, who brought seeds back from Durban, South Africa in the 1970s — drawn by a landrace that flowered in roughly sixty days, remarkably fast for an equatorial sativa. Rosenthal passed the seeds to botanist and author Mel Frank, who worked the gene pool to raise resin production and shorten flowering time; Frank in turn passed it to David Watson ("Sam the Skunkman"), who stabilized it over several growing seasons before relocating to Amsterdam with his seed stock in the mid-1980s. In Amsterdam it entered the commercial seed trade — including Nevil Schoenmakers' Seed Bank, among the first to distribute cannabis genetics internationally — and spread globally from there. Why breeders chose Durban over other sativas

The Bay Area cannabis scene in the early 2010s had access to most major sativa genetics: Haze descendants, Sour Diesel, Jack Herer, Trainwreck, and their derivatives. The Cookie Fam chose Durban Poison as the sativa parent in the GSC cross, not those alternatives. The reasons reflect what Durban contributes that more complex sativa hybrids don't.

Clean genetics, predictable outcome. A true landrace carries a single, well-understood genetic character. Haze is a four-parent hybrid (Colombian × Thai × Mexican × South Indian) whose extreme complexity and variable flowering time made it unpredictable in crosses. Sour Diesel's exact parentage is disputed — likely Chemdawg 91 × Super Skunk, with possible Massachusetts Super Skunk involvement — and its diesel-fuel terpene character is largely incompatible with OG Kush's earthy-doughy profile. Trainwreck (Mexican × Thai × Afghani) has a faster onset but also introduces a sharper anxiety ceiling than Durban's cleaner, more controlled sativa energy. Durban Poison, as a pure landrace, introduces exactly one thing: the Terpinolene-Ocimene sativa character, without confounding variables.

Practical flowering time. Pure equatorial sativas — Colombian, Thai, Jamaican landrace — typically run 14–16 weeks to flower, which makes them impractical for most breeders. Durban Poison flowers in 8–9 weeks, short for a pure sativa, which is one reason it survived commercial breeding where most other African landraces didn't. A breeder crossing OG Kush with a 16-week sativa would wait half a year per generation. Durban's flowering time made it compatible with standard indoor cultivation practices.

Terpene complementarity with OG Kush. OG Kush is Caryophyllene-dominant — earthy, slightly diesel, with a doughy sweetness. Durban Poison is Terpinolene-dominant — sweet pine, herbal sage, faint anise. These two terpene families are complementary rather than competing: Caryophyllene provides depth and body weight; Terpinolene provides the light, bright front end. In the resulting GSC cross, OG Kush's Caryophyllene dominates the terpene panel (which is why GSC reads as earthy-sweet rather than piney), but Durban's contribution shows up in the elevated THC ceiling, the fast euphoric onset, and a subtle sweet brightness that distinguishes GSC from other OG hybrids of the era.

The terpene story: Terpinolene into Caryophyllene

The most counterintuitive thing about Durban Poison's contribution to the Cookies family tree is what it didn't pass on. Durban Poison leads with Terpinolene and Ocimene — a fresh, herbal, sweet-pine aroma profile unlike almost anything else in modern cannabis. By GSC, those terpenes are mostly gone. Caryophyllene from OG Kush dominates, and the Cookies family's characteristic earthy-doughy-sweet aroma is an OG Kush terpene signature, not Durban's.

This is how terpene dominance works in hybrid breeding: the terpene pattern of the more Caryophyllene-heavy parent tends to dominate in the offspring when crossed with a Terpinolene-dominant parent. Caryophyllene is the most common dominant terpene in modern cannabis genetics precisely because OG Kush, Chemdawg, and their descendants — all Caryophyllene-dominant — have been used so heavily in breeding. Durban Poison's Terpinolene character was always going to be partially diluted in the GSC cross; what remained in the offspring was the effect architecture (fast onset, high ceiling, euphoric quality) rather than the terpene fingerprint.

The GSC cross: what each parent contributed

Understanding GSC as a two-parent cross makes it easier to recognize Durban's contribution at every generation downstream.

OG Kush's contribution to GSC: dense resin production, a high THC floor, Caryophyllene-dominant terpene profile (earthy, slightly doughy, mildly fuel-edged), and a body weight that anchors the otherwise sativa-forward onset. The settling, relaxed quality in the second phase of a GSC experience — the shift from mental engagement to body relaxation — is OG Kush. So is the dense, sticky flower structure that made GSC so appealing to producers.

Durban Poison's contribution to GSC: the fast euphoric onset, the elevated mental engagement at peak effect, the THC ceiling that gave GSC's potency its range, and the subtle sweet brightness in the aroma that sets GSC apart from other OG-based hybrids. The distinctive GSC effect arc — fast and euphoric at onset, relaxing at the body level as the session extends — is the two-parent story in action. Without Durban, you have a standard OG Kush derivative. Without OG Kush, you have a fast, cerebral sativa with nothing to ground it. The combination created something neither parent produced alone.

The "F1 Durban" used in the GSC cross was a first-generation selection from the original Durban landrace seed stock — not an additional generation of crossing, but a selected phenotype of the pure landrace. This is part of why Durban's genetics integrated cleanly: the F1 retained the essential landrace character rather than introducing additional hybrid complexity.

Generation 1: Direct GSC children at Vermont dispensaries

Every first-generation GSC child carries approximately 25% Durban Poison genetics — and the OG Kush side of the parent is typically amplified by crossing GSC with another indica-dominant or Caryophyllene-dominant partner.

Sunset Sherbet (GSC × Pink Panties)

Sherbinskis' Sunset Sherbet crossed GSC with Pink Panties, a Blackberry Kush-derived clone. The result leans more indica-dominant than GSC, with a candy-fruit aroma layered over GSC's earthy base. Sunset Sherbet is important not only as a standalone strain but as one of the two parents of Gelato — it passes its fruit aroma and indica body weight into the next generation.

GMO Cookies (GSC × Chemdawg)

Also called "Garlic Cookies," GMO Cookies stacks two Caryophyllene-dominant parents — GSC and Chemdawg — producing one of the most pungently skunk-and-garlic-forward strains on the market. The Durban Poison ancestry is deeply diluted by two generations of Caryophyllene dominance; the effect, however, retains the fast-onset euphoric quality before a heavy indica body effect takes over. Night-use only for most consumers. Available at many Vermont dispensaries.

Tropicana Cookies (GSC × Tangie)

The one GSC child where Durban's legacy shows up in aroma as well as effect. Tropicana Cookies (Oni Seed Co.) crossed GSC with Tangie — a Caryophyllene-Limonene dominant cross of California Orange × Skunk #1 — and the Limonene from Tangie's citrus genetics introduced a bright orange-citrus brightness that echoes Durban Poison's sweet, light-aromatic contribution. Tropicana Cookies is the most uplifting and energetic of GSC's direct children; its Limonene-Caryophyllene dual-lead profile produces a daytime-capable hybrid that most Cookies-family strains aren't. The full profile is in the Tropicana Cookies spotlight.

Do-Si-Dos (GSC × Face Off OG)

Archive Seed Bank's Do-Si-Dos crossed GSC with Face Off OG, a potent OG Kush phenotype. The result doubles down on the indica side — deeply body-heavy, Caryophyllene-dominant, with a sweet-cookie aroma base and powerful relaxing effects. Of all the direct GSC children, Do-Si-Dos retains the least of Durban Poison's sativa character and the most of OG Kush's settling body weight.

Animal Cookies (GSC × Fire OG)

BC Bud Depot's Animal Cookies crossed GSC with Fire OG, introducing a second OG Kush derivative into the mix. Animal Cookies became important as a parent in the Wedding Cake line: Animal Cookies was crossed with SinMint Cookies — itself a Thin Mint GSC × Blue Power cross from Sin City Seeds — to create Animal Mints, which was then crossed with Triangle Kush to create Wedding Cake. Because both of Animal Mints' parents carry GSC ancestry (Animal Cookies is GSC × Fire OG; SinMint Cookies carries Thin Mint GSC), Wedding Cake inherits Durban Poison genetics through two separate GSC-lineage lines. Note that Animal Mints' exact parentage is debated — Seed Junky has published little — but Animal Cookies × SinMint Cookies is the most commonly cited version.

Generation 2: GSC grandchildren

The second generation is where the Cookies family tree branches most broadly — and where most strains on Vermont dispensary menus live.

Gelato (Sunset Sherbet × Thin Mint GSC)

Sherbinskis' Gelato cross — Sunset Sherbet crossed with Thin Mint GSC — produced the strain that defines a generation of cannabis aesthetics. Both parents are GSC descendants, meaning Gelato carries double GSC input and approximately 25–37% Durban Poison ancestry by genetic contribution. The dominant character is Caryophyllene and Limonene — berry-cream, fruity, lush — with none of Durban's Terpinolene signature remaining in most Gelato phenotypes. What persists is the effect architecture: Gelato's characteristic balanced onset (euphoric and mentally engaging before settling into body relaxation) traces in part to Durban's contribution through both GSC parents. Wedding Cake (Triangle Kush × Animal Mints)

Seed Junky Genetics' Wedding Cake (also called Triangle Mints #23, and Pink Cookies in Canada) crosses Triangle Kush with an Animal Mints male. Animal Mints is most commonly cited as Animal Cookies × SinMint Cookies — and since Animal Cookies is GSC × Fire OG and SinMint Cookies carries Thin Mint GSC, Wedding Cake inherits Durban Poison ancestry through the GSC on both sides of Animal Mints. The lineage runs: Durban Poison → GSC → (Animal Cookies / SinMint Cookies) → Animal Mints → Wedding Cake. At this many generations removed, Durban's terpene signature is gone; what remains is Caryophyllene-dominant vanilla-cake sweetness and a warm, relaxing indica-leaning effect. Generation 3: Great-grandchildren

Runtz (Zkittlez × Gelato)

Cookies SF and Dying Breed's Runtz cross — Zkittlez paired with Gelato — is the most widely recognized third-generation Durban Poison descendant. Zkittlez itself is a Grape Ape × Grapefruit cross, bringing its own fruity character; Gelato brings the GSC double-ancestry. Runtz is roughly 12–18% Durban Poison by genetic contribution, leads with Caryophyllene and Limonene, and has none of Durban's Terpinolene signature. It tests 19–25% THC at Vermont dispensaries, has a candy-grape-sweet aroma, and delivers a balanced onset before a relaxing finish — still carrying, distantly, the Cookies family effect arc that Durban seeded. Reading the COA for Durban Poison's legacy at the Vermont counter

Vermont's Cannabis Control Board requires licensed dispensaries to display terpene test results for flower products. This makes it possible to trace the Cookies-family genetics from the counter — and to understand exactly where Durban Poison's influence shows up, and where it doesn't.

Buying Durban Poison itself: Look for Terpinolene in the lead position on the COA. If Myrcene leads instead, the batch has a different phenotype expression and will feel more sedating and less focused than the classic Durban profile. Ocimene should appear somewhere in the terpene panel — it's the herbal-sage note that distinguishes Durban from Jack Herer (also Terpinolene-dominant but without Ocimene's herbal character). A batch with high total terpenes (2%+) will be more aromatic and characterful than a low-terpene batch.

Buying Cookies-family strains: For any GSC descendant — Gelato, Dosidos, GMO, Tropicana Cookies, Runtz — look for Caryophyllene in the lead position. Caryophyllene is the genetic signal of Cookies-family ancestry; if another terpene dominates, the product may be using the name for a different genetic cross. Tropicana Cookies is the exception: Caryophyllene often co-leads with Limonene, reflecting the Tangie parent's citrus genetics. Runtz and its derivatives should show Caryophyllene and Limonene leading.

How does the Durban Poison family differ from the Haze and Trainwreck sativa families? +
All three are foundational sativa lineages, but they work through completely different mechanisms and produce different strain families. The Haze family — detailed in the Haze strain family guide — traces to a 1960s–70s California cross of Colombian, Thai, Mexican, and South Indian landraces. Haze introduced extremely complex, slow-maturing genetics that bred into Jack Herer, Super Silver Haze, Amnesia Haze, and Blue Dream; it's a multi-landrace hybrid whose cerebral effects and complex terpene character flow through the sativa-dominant half of the modern gene pool. The Trainwreck family — covered in the Trainwreck strain family guide — is a NorCal three-parent hybrid (Mexican × Thai × Afghani) whose Terpinolene character and fast onset showed up most famously in Pineapple Express (Trainwreck × Hawaiian). The Durban family works differently from both: Durban is a single-origin pure landrace, genetically simpler than Haze, and its influence in the modern market came through one specific cross (GSC) rather than through a series of sativa-to-sativa pairings. Haze seeded a sativa dynasty; Trainwreck seeded a NorCal sativa tree; Durban Poison seeded the indica-hybrid Cookies dynasty — its pure-sativa genetics became the catalyst for the most widely planted modern hybrid family, not another sativa family.
